For the first two weeks I do not add a single Amendment just moistened mix and the seed. The seeds cotyledons have enough nutrients in them to feed for the first 2 weeks. After transplant they get some small amount of fertilizer and a little bit of calcium.

Same here. I start seeds in straight DE which provides nothing but moisture--that's all they need to sprout and start growing.

About two weeks after germination I start giving them a weekly dose of a liquid fertilizer at half the recommended strength.
